  "title": "The terms should cover user-generated content",
  "statement": "The terms of service must include a user-content clause covering licence, takedown and a DMCA agent.",
  "rationale": "Where customers post reviews, photos or replies the business needs permission to display them, and the licence clause is that permission — without it every republished review is unlicensed. The DMCA agent is what preserves the safe harbour when somebody complains about a post.",

  "remediation": "Add the user-content clause where the service accepts any user submissions, including reviews. Done when the terms say what you may do with what customers post and how to complain about a post.",
  "example": "When you post a review or photo you give Acme Coffee permission to display it. To report content, email legal@acmecoffee.com.",
  "notes": "Conditional on the service accepting user content, which no applicability dimension expresses; the criteria pass immediately where it does not.",
